- [ ] Per-tenant rate quotas: before you ship, double-check that the new Quotaline limits are loaded for all tenants in the Selbourne cluster, not just the pilot batch. Last time the sync job skipped anyone created after the cutoff, and support got noisy fast. Run the quota audit script, eyeball the two biggest tenants, and confirm 429s return the friendly retry header. Paste the audit run's token below for the record.

build token for kagaf-hahof: htk14_9d3d4d26d7d8de

## Restock Planner Onboarding

The Fizzcart planner ingests cabinet inventory snapshots every hour and emits restock routes for drivers. Review changes against the routing fixtures in /testdata before approving. Local runs need a populated env file; copy env.sample and fill in the depot region. The planner API credential goes on the line immediately after this file's header.

vault entry, yahaf-tagug: LEDGER_TOKEN20=884d77d1a8b98aa4edfb

Handover Note — Supplier Contract Renewal. To the sales leads: as I transition duties to Director Malvo Trent, please note the Orvandale Components contract expires at the end of Q3. Pricing discussions began last month; their team signalled a 6% uplift, which we consider negotiable given our volume growth on the Brindlecore line. Keep all renewal correspondence routed through the commercial office, and avoid committing to multi-year terms before the leadership session. The strategic rationale is summarised immediately below.

management briefing: The southern region missed its Oliox quota by 51.7 percent last quarter. Juldorek Freight plans to raise the Silath list price by 49.7 percent in January. The board signed off on a budget of $388.0 million for Project Casok. The renewal with Fradorix Foods closes at $53.0 million a year, 49.8 percent below the last contract.

Finance Review — Loyalty Overhaul

The Kestrel Rewards relaunch cleared budget review. Redemption liability drops an estimated 12% under the new tier structure. Points expiry shortens to 18 months. Sales leads: expect top-tier churn noise in month one; retention offers are funded. Full rollout targets Q2, pilot in the Darnwick region first. Strategic context follows below.

board note of fafog-yahap: Project Rusdor slips by a full year because of the audit delay.